'If he leaves in 6 months he will regret' - Ex-Napoli striker criticises Osimhen for not celebrating his goals
Published: October 01, 2023
Ex-Napoli striker Roberto Sosa has criticized Victor Osimhen for his refusal to celebrate his goals in the club's recent wins over Lecce and Udinese.
The Super Eagles striker didn't celebrate when he bagged a goal in Napoli's 4-1 win over Udinese last Wednesday which brought an end to his four-game goal drought.
He repeated the same yesterday when the Parthenopeans triumphed over Lecce on matchday 7 of the Serie A played at Stadio Comunale Via del Mare.
This behaviour of the lanky striker stems from his ongoing row with the club.
Sosa has said that the 24-year-old will regret his choice when he leaves Napoli and the fans don't deserve such attitude.
"I would like to go to Castel Volturno to tell him. I hope Osimhen stays, but if he leaves in 6 months he will regret these goals without celebration and will not be able to go back. I regret this choice to be sad.
"This club was chosen by Diego for its fans. Like Boca and Gimnasia. They don't deserve this. The goal is the best thing, I'm very sorry about this choice of Osimhen." he told Tele A via Area Napoli
Regardless of the recent tussle between the defending Italian champions and Osimhen, the club's manager Rudi Garcia will be happy that the Nigerian forward is back to his prolific ways having netted in back-to-back games.
The Naples-based club are seeking to defend the Scudetto having ended their 33-year wait for the title last season and have had a decent start to the campaign, garnering 14 points from 7 games played so far.
